Closed mrehan27 closed 1 year ago
Pull request title looks good 👍!
If this pull request gets merged, it will cause a new release of the software. Example: If this project's latest release version is 1.0.0
. If this pull request gets merged in, the next release of this project will be 1.1.0
. This pull request is not a breaking change.
All merged pull requests will eventually get deployed. But some types of pull requests will trigger a deployment (such as features and bug fixes) while some pull requests will wait to get deployed until a later time.
Hey, there @mrehan27 👋🤖. I'm a bot here to help you.
⚠️ Pull requests into the branch main
typically only allows changes with the types: fix
. From the pull request title, the type of change this pull request is trying to complete is: feat
. ⚠️
This pull request might still be allowed to be merged. However, you might want to consider make this pull request merge into a different branch other then main
.
Merging #181 (97cea9b) into main (3ed104a) will decrease coverage by
1.52%
. The diff coverage is8.33%
.
@@ Coverage Diff @@
## main #181 +/- ##
============================================
- Coverage 63.52% 62.01% -1.52%
Complexity 218 218
============================================
Files 91 93 +2
Lines 2051 2106 +55
Branches 263 272 +9
============================================
+ Hits 1303 1306 +3
- Misses 646 698 +52
Partials 102 102
Impacted Files | Coverage Δ | |
---|---|---|
...essagingpush/CustomerIOFirebaseMessageProcessor.kt | 0.00% <0.00%> (ø) |
|
...ssagingpush/CustomerIOFirebaseMessagingReceiver.kt | 0.00% <0.00%> (ø) |
|
...essagingpush/CustomerIOFirebaseMessagingService.kt | 0.00% <0.00%> (ø) |
|
.../customer/messagingpush/di/DiGraphMessagingPush.kt | 11.11% <0.00%> (-17.47%) |
:arrow_down: |
...ustomer/messagingpush/MessagingPushModuleConfig.kt | 91.30% <71.42%> (-8.70%) |
:arrow_down: |
Help us with your feedback. Take ten seconds to tell us how you rate us. Have a feature suggestion? Share it here.
Build available to test
Version: feat-push-broadcast-receiver-SNAPSHOT
Repository: https://s01.oss.sonatype.org/content/repositories/snapshots/
@levibostian I have replied to your comment. Looks like you are looking at the wrong issue. Please read PR background in linked issue to understand the changes better.
Closing this as we decided not to continue with these changes for now
closes: https://github.com/customerio/issues/issues/9593
Changes
CustomerIOFirebaseMessageProcessor
to process all notification callbacks received from a single placeCustomerIOFirebaseMessagingReceiver
to receive FCM messages without registeringFirebaseMessagingService
ignoreMessageWithInvalidId
config flag to suppress messages processed outside FCM